POJ 2109 - double

来源:互联网 发布:java oa系统开源代码 编辑:程序博客网 时间:2024/05/11 00:52

1.Question:

本题的正解是高精度+二分法
但是题目的bug导致我们直接一行用double也可作

二分+高精度我之后会补上
这里的blog相当于是插了个flag吧

2.Code:

#include"iostream"#include"cstring"#include"cstdio"#include"cmath"using namespace std;double n,p;int main(){while(scanf("%lf%lf",&n,&p)!=EOF){cout<<pow(p,1/n)<<endl;}return 0;} 


0 0
原创粉丝点击